#3c4cfd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3c4cfd is composed of 23.5% red, 29.8%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.3% cyan, 70%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 235 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 61.4%. #3c4cfd color hex could be obtained by blending #7898ff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#3c4cfd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3c4cfd has RGB values of R:60, G:76,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 3951869.

Hex triplet 3c4cfd #3c4cfd
RGB Decimal 60, 76, 253 rgb(60,76,253)
RGB Percent 23.5, 29.8, 99.2 rgb(23.5%,29.8%,99.2%)
CMYK 76, 70, 0, 1
HSL 235°, 98, 61.4 hsl(235,98%,61.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 235°, 76.3, 99.2
Web Safe 3333ff #3333ff
CIE-LAB 43.093, 53.092, -88.76
XYZ 22.174, 13.22, 94.306
xyY 0.171, 0.102, 13.22
CIE-LCH 43.093, 103.427, 300.886
CIE-LUV 43.093, -12.125, -129.957
Hunter-Lab 36.359, 45.231, -128.331
Binary 00111100, 01001100, 11111101

Shades and Tints of #3c4cfd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000213 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3c4cfd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9798a2 is the less saturated color, while #3c4cfd is the most saturated one.
